Bryant Ridge's Analysis:
A Eddystone Arsenal Model of 1917 that has been sporterized represents a fascinating chapter in the long postwar life of this iconic American service rifle. Originally designed as a robust and accurate military arm for World War I, the Model of 1917’s rugged action and long 26-inch barrel made it an ideal platform for conversion into a hunting or sporting rifle once military surplus stocks became widely available. Sporterization typically involved trimming down the full-length military stock to a sleeker profile, removing the handguard and military hardware, and sometimes shortening the barrel for improved handling in the field. Many conversions also added new front sights, upgraded adjustable rear sights or scopes, and refinished or reshaped walnut stocks with more graceful lines, recoil pads, and checkering. The end result was often a lighter, more agile, and aesthetically refined rifle that retained the strength of its original Mauser-style action while being better suited to hunting deer, elk, and other North American game. Mechanically, the sporterized Model 1917 retains the strong dual-lug bolt action, controlled-feed extractor, and five-round internal magazine that made the design reliable under combat conditions. These same qualities made it equally dependable in the hunting fields, where adverse weather and rugged terrain demand a firearm that functions flawlessly. Many gunsmiths also rebarreled sporterized examples in popular hunting calibers beyond the original .30-06 Springfield, further enhancing their versatility. While such alterations typically removed much of the rifle’s collector value as a military artifact, they created highly serviceable sporting arms that were prized by hunters for decades. Today, a sporterized Eddystone Model 1917 stands as a testament to the ingenuity of mid-20th-century American gunsmiths and the enduring utility of a design that bridged the gap between battlefield durability and sporting elegance.
